In this episode of The Smarter Planner Podcast, host Belle Osvath, CFP®, welcomes David Keller, CMT, President and Chief Strategist at Sierra Alpha Research, a boutique investment research and consulting firm. David is also a CNBC contributor and the host of the Market Misbehavior YouTube channel and podcast, where he helps investors and advisors better understand market behavior through technical analysis and storytelling.
With a unique background blending finance, psychology, and creative storytelling, David shares how he built a business around content creation and why video, podcasts, and social media are becoming essential tools for advisors looking to build trust and connect with clients.
In this conversation, David shares:
- Why advisors should embrace content creation and start before they feel "ready"
- How authentic, human content stands out in a world increasingly filled with AI-generated noise
- The importance of thinking beyond posting content and building a true "channel" or media platform
- Practical tools and strategies for growing a presence, including analytics, coaching, and consistency
- How content helps shift investors from emotional decision-making to evidence-based thinking
David also explains how his own journey - from corporate roles at firms like Fidelity and Bloomberg to launching his own firm - was driven by a desire to communicate more effectively and connect with audiences in a more meaningful way. He emphasizes that advisors who show up consistently, share insights clearly, and present themselves as real people can build stronger relationships and stand out in a crowded marketplace.
